Mouse not working
Posted by Matt on March 23rd, 2007


Hi,
I am having a terrible problem with my mouse recently. It's been working
fine for a long time, but now the left click button no longer clicks, but it
acts as a scroll, so when I press it to click on something it does not click,
it just scrolls down. It's unbelievably annoying, as I cannot get anything
done with this. I have looked all over the help topics and cannot find
anything about the issue. I'd really appreciate it if someone could help me
out with this. Thanks
Matt

Posted by Byte on March 24th, 2007


Go to: Start>Run>type DEVMGMT.MSC and press OK.
Scroll down to "Mice and Other Pointing Devices" and
see if there is a yellow exclamation (!) or yellow question (?)
mark on it, which would indicate problems. If not, click the
small (+) sign and rightclick the device and click Properties.
There you can troubleshoot, uninstall, check drivers, etc.
